How we determine the price we offer
When you contact us to sell your designer bag or jewelry, we ask that you provide as many details as possible – condition, year of production, accompaniments, and detailed photographs. We also request your price expectations to ensure we are aligned.
The payment we offer is based on the style’s popularity, the item’s condition and age, the estimated time to sell, prices of comparable pieces on the market, and other factors.
All purchase prices are negotiated individually, but we typically pay between 75% and 85% of our estimate of the item’s selling price, depending on its dollar value. -
Sale VS Consignment
While we try to offer outright purchase whenever possible, there are items we prefer to take on consignment, such as smaller leather goods, exotics, and pre-owned bags. Consigned bags are handled and marketed the same way as owned bags, and the time to sale is typically the same.
When we offer both outright purchase and consignment, consignment usually provides a greater payout. Therefore, consignment may be preferable for those seeking to maximize the return on their bags.
